Fabio
CD lamb, he's going to be a target monster, but an ADOT scrub. So ADOT is a average depth of target. So all hope for CD lamb is not completely lost. Since Cooper Rush has taken over as QB, CD is Y receiver 16 in the last three weeks. It's not terrible, but it's definitely not a far cry from your expectation of an overall Y receiver one at the beginning of the season.
00:08:59
Fabio
For him to sustain some level of production, he's going to need targets and a lot of them. Just to put these in the context, in weeks one to seven, with Dak, his yards per route run was 2.51, which is like, I want to say top 10, probably even top five in they in in the weeks one to seven, just like we spoke about yesterday on the pod with Nico Collins and Juwan Jennings and Justin Jefferson.
00:09:22
Fabio
In the last three weeks, his yards for route run is 1.24.
00:09:26
Fabio
In the same time span, his average, yeah, that's a big drop-off. In the same, it's half basically.
00:09:31
Fabio
In the same time span, his average FF target was 9.95. So figure 10 yards when he was receiving passes from Dak Prescott. Now it's 6.8. So big drop-offs, but he also went from averaging about nine targets per game to now 11.
00:09:47
Fabio
He's going to need quantity to sustain decent production since the quality now is on IR. And with the up in targets, I think he's on pace right now for 170 targets, which is about nine less than last year. So you're obviously most likely still going to be holding on to CV lamb. I think Y receiver two production high-end Y receiver two production for the rest of the year is sustainable, but you're obviously not happy about that going down for the rest of the season. and

00:21:27
Fabio
Remondre Stevenson versus Miami. So, Mondre actually has been a sneaky RB9 in the last four weeks and has been seeing a big chunk of volume both in the rushing game, where in the three of the last four games he's had 20 carries, as well as in the passing game with a minimum of three receptions in three of the last four games as well.
00:21:44
Fabio
On top of that, since the bye week, Gibson hasn't had a game of more than five carries. So this is clearly Madre's world and we're all just living in it. He gets a really nice matchup versus the Finns in the 305. And they've been giving up the ninth most fantasy points to running backs this season. I don't expect a high scoring game, but just like their face first face off in week five, I'm expecting a low end RB one production with a good PPR floor. So you can start them with great confidence. Low key or Madre Stevenson has had like constant three
00:22:16
Fabio
Games of three receptions for receptions like he's really really utilized in the P in the PPR game and I forgot like two years ago He finished the season with six and nine receptions. So it's ah he's really giving you a good floor as far as PPR is concerned Yep,

I have Kyron Williams versus the Eagles in Sunday Night Football.
00:40:35
Nacc
Oh, now we're coming out firing guys.
00:40:36
Roger Emeka
So the, well, I've been a bit choosing some like lesser known players. So I try to get a ah big face here.
00:40:47
Roger Emeka
So, but yeah, I don't like the matchup for Kyron Williams versus the Eagles. So the Kyron Williams revenge tour was on fire in the first seven games of the season. He was healthy, looked great and was averaging 20 fantasy points per game.
00:40:59
Roger Emeka
But over the last three games since Cooper and ah cooper Cup and Pukanakua have been back at full swing, he's averaged only 12 fantasy points per game and only six receptions in those three games. The Eagles have the best-run defense in the league behind the Chiefs, and I expect Kyron to struggle this week and to not get burned again. I expect not to get burned again like I did with Ekler versus the Eagles last week, so we shall see. But a very tough tough matchup in a big game between the Rams and the Eagles.

00:42:28
Roger Emeka
Second half of the week is Jalen Waddle versus the Patriots. I think we all agree it's been a difficult season for dolphins wide receivers dealing with the Tua injury. And even when Tua has been back, John o Smith and Devon H.N. have been revelations as pass catchers.
00:42:45
Roger Emeka
And while Tiger kill has benefited from Tua's return, Waddle meanwhile has only had one game above the double digit fantasy points in the season and is averaging 7.6 fantasy points per game in his past four games since Tua's return. Plessy faces a Patriots team that plays the second most man coverage in the league at 40%. And Waddle only has 0.32 fantasy points per route run versus man defense.
00:43:15
Roger Emeka
So that's 62 routes he's run.
00:43:17
Roger Emeka
Nine catches, 102 yards. That's pretty bad efficiency. It's basically taking him like three games to get, to get to that mark just against man coverage.
